What are the top most famous Politics quotes by Woodrow Wilson?

Here are the top most famous quotes about Politics by Woodrow Wilson.

  • My dream of politics all my life has been that it is the common business, that it is something we owe to each other to understand and discuss with absolute frankness.
  • I have long enjoyed the friendship and companionship of Republicans because I am by instinct a teacher, and I would like to teach them something.
  • A conservative is a man who just sits and thinks, mostly sits.
  • A conservative is someone who makes no changes and consults his grandmother when in doubt.
  • Politics I conceive to be nothing more than the science of the ordered progress of society along the lines of greatest usefulness and convenience to itself.
